我有一个完全用 Flash 开发的网站。现在网站所有者不想转向更多基于文本/html 的网站。因此,我计划创建一个替代的基于 html/text 的站点,googlebot 将被重定向到该站点。(通过检查用户代理)。我的问题是,这是谷歌官方允许的吗?
如果不是,那么与用户相比,为什么有许多基于订阅的网站向谷歌显示不同的数据集?这是允许的吗?
非常感谢你。
我已经为大型电子商务网站处理了这种确切的情况,而 Google 基本上忽略了该网站。谷歌认为它隐藏并直接在这里解决它并说:
伪装是指向用户和搜索引擎呈现不同内容或 URL 的做法。根据用户代理提供不同的结果可能会导致您的网站被视为具有欺骗性并从 Google 索引中删除。
相反,创建一个符合 ADA 标准的网站版本,以便具有屏幕阅读器和视力辅助工具的用户可以使用您的网站。只要有从您的主页到符合 ADA 标准的页面的链接,Google 就会将它们编入索引。
官方建议似乎是:提供指向该网站非 Flash 版本的可见链接。愚弄 googlebot 肯定会惹上麻烦。请记住,Google 结果将链接到匹配页面!不要做出无用的结果。
谷歌已经索引了 Flash 内容,所以我的建议是检查你的网站是如何被索引的。也许你不需要做任何事情。
从 Google 的角度来看,我不认为显示该网站的替代版本是好的。
如果您使用完全相同的地址提供您的页面,那么您可能没问题。例如,如果您显示“ http://www.somesite.com/ ”但将 googlebot 引导至“ http://www.somesite.com/alt.htm ”,则 Google 可能会将搜索用户引导至 alt.htm。你不想这样,对吧?
这称为伪装。我不确定它的影响是什么,但它肯定不是白帽。我很确定谷歌现在正在研究一种抓取 Flash 的方法,所以它甚至可能不是一个问题。
我假设您实际上并没有进行重定向,而是进行了 PHP 导入或类似的操作,因此它显示为同一页面。如果您实际上是在重定向,那么它只会像往常一样索引其他页面。
一些网站提供不同级别的内容——他们限制内容,他们不提供替代和额外的内容。这样做是为了不索引不相关的事物。